Assistant Director of Alumni Engagement
Responsibilities
- Alumni Networks and Affinity Programming (40%)
- Create engagement strategies and programmatic opportunities tailored to alumni networks and affinity groups
- Serve as primary liaison to alumni network and affinity group leaders, providing guidance, resources, and regular communication
- Collaborate with campus partners to support university-wide efforts by integrating alumni into relevant initiatives
- Volunteer Engagement and Management (30%)
- Recruit, train (where needed), support, and facilitate opportunities for alumni volunteers
- Manage engagement opportunities for alumni interested in mentoring, speaking, admissions support, or student-alumni connections
- Maintain a regular volunteer communications cadence
- Track and analyze volunteer engagement to inform future outreach and strategy
- Revenue Generation Programs and General Administration (30%)
- Oversee and promote alumni benefit programs that drive non-philanthropic revenue and alumni participation
- Collaborate with campus partners to develop revenue streams to support alumni engagement efforts
- Promote and track alumni participation in benefit programs
- Maintain program budgets, track engagement metrics, and prepare reports for leadership
- Aid with day-to-day administrative needs to ensure smooth execution of programming and strategic initiatives
About the Role
The Assistant Director will play a key role in cultivating an engaged and connected alumni community by developing and managing alumni networks, affinity groups, and volunteer initiatives that foster pride, participation, and lasting relationships with Quinnipiac.
